This Memorial day weekend I refreshed my brake caliper finish, painted Lug nuts and Brake rotor hubs. I wasn't ready to repaint and decal so I short cut by scraping off peeling clear coat, scrubbing calipers with soap and polishing pad. Looked way better just doing that. With the Clear coat, I am very happy with the finished product. Way better then the peeling faded calipers before. I also took time to paint the Rotor hubs and lug nuts.
I'm going to have to repaint in a year or so. That's when I'll add SS lines and do a brake overhaul

Today I fixed my passenger side door lock mechanism. It was behaving erratically sometimes no longer dropping the window to clear the rain gutters.

Did some snooping around on the Internet and found a fix that involves re-soldering the pcb inside the door lock mechanism. Not terribly difficult but ask me how many times I put things back together the wrong way...
